Output ccc182e03531f8d1fda0057cd36c519fc7609f7c5a7dffbdc95406ccbd47f0e6:1

value
586025817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e59ec636cce7a7b20f3504c06e6ad44bcd40866a OP_EQUAL
address
3Nd8sJX4drSvTtWLotZ1yRez5UAbQQSBmM
transaction
ccc182e03531f8d1fda0057cd36c519fc7609f7c5a7dffbdc95406ccbd47f0e6
confirmations
158955
spent
true